The policeman in question is James Richard Crean.
I can find no record of him serving in the RIC or DMP.

He was born in January 1884
https://civilrecords.irishgenealogy.ie/churchrecords/images/birth_returns/births_1884/02704/1995647.pdf

In 1911 he is at home, stated to be aged 25, actually 27,  a "farmer's son"
http://www.census.nationalarchives.ie/reels/nai003587917/

Yet when he died aged 33 in 1917, also at home, he is stated to be a policeman.
https://civilrecords.irishgenealogy.ie/churchrecords/images/deaths_returns/deaths_1917/05209/4440292.pdf

So I wonder, where and when did he serve as a policeman?
